Summary

  • Tuesday’s Paris show doubled as a music premiere, with Pharrell Williams unveiling new songs featuring Quavo, Lil Baby, YoungBoy Never Broke Again and Angelique Kidjo.
  • The Louis Vuitton Menswear Spring-Summer 2027 soundtrack opened with Quavo’s “Haavin,” moved through Lil Baby’s “Dead Fresh” and YoungBoy’s “Simulation,” and closed with Kidjo’s “Bando” featuring Williams and Quavo.
  • Thomas Roussel conducted L’Orchestre du Pont Neuf live during the show, while Voices of Fire added vocals to music recorded at the Louis Vuitton Studio.
  • Since taking over Louis Vuitton menswear in 2023, Williams has repeatedly used runway shows to preview music, including January’s Fall-Winter 2026 presentation with A$AP Rocky, Pusha T, John Legend, Quavo and Jackson Wang.
